New apostolic reformation (NAR) and Bethel are bad news. The New Apostolic Reformation (NAR) is a popular and fast-growing new movement of 'Christians' who emphasize signs and wonders and teach that God is giving new revelation through new apostles and prophets today. Some churches associated with those teachings have even become household namesβ€”you’ve probably heard of the widely influential Bethel Church, for example. NAR has its own translation of the Bible called the passion which they assert Jesus Christ personally commissioned one of their "apostles" to translate. It is focused on regaining what it calls the 7 mountains, which are earthly powers like finance, politics etc to bring about Christian dominion on earth. They believe they are the new prophets and leaders of Christianity in the coming age and are heavily focused on spiritual gifts like prophecy, which they believe is of private interpretation. Remember the "ashbury revival"? That was NAR(Spiritual right, masculine, militant) Bethel is a new age movement with Christian aesthetics. It is one of the largest producers of contemporary Christian music, and aided by radio stations like K-LOVE they dominate the airwaves of Christian worship in and out of churches across North America. It was born in California from the hippy adjacent Jesus movement. They focus on healing and miracles, gifts like tongues are seen as confirmation of the Holy Spirit. The physics of heaven (promoted literature) puts forth that the new age movement got things right that the church didn't and they should be reconciled with Christ. (Spiritual left, feminine, nurturing) Though you would think these groups would he in conflict they actually have a lot of overlap and the same people are behind both. Both groups are focused on what God could do for them today, in their temporal lives, with material abundance. Since they rely heavily on "spiritual gifts" as confirmation of the Holy Spirit any real Christian, who isn't going to fake gifts for acceptance, that comes against them is dismissed as an empty vessel, or worse, an agent of Satan.
